Yav-Hoo!



Our 2024 pitching staff has grown by four more arms from Yavapai College in Arizona.

Along with lefty Nick Woodcock who we announced a few weeks ago, Carter Boone, Austin Humphres and Eli Oshiro will join on club.

Boone is a tall lengthy righty that has split time starting and coming out of the pen this spring. He has a victory after six starts (12 appearances), thrown 37 innings and has struck out 37 batters.

Sophomore lefthander Humphres had made an impressive 21 appearances this spring, has recoded two wins and a pair of saves. Over the course of 31.1 innings he has fanned 37 batters.

Freshman righthander Oshiro has thrown 23.1 innings this spring, appearing in 13 games. He has two wins and has struck out 32 along the way.
